It has been perched in the forested Panchoy Valley for more than 450 years, was one of the Americas' largest cities around the time of the Spanish Armada, and was nearly wiped off the map by an earthquake three years before the U.S. Declaration of Independence was signed. Even its name means old. But it's new to the thousands of tourists arriving from every corner of the globe every day. Submit stories now -- ADVERTORIAL -- The 'best little zoo in the world' A solo adventurer's paradise See it to Belize it Costa Rica au naturel Scuba & relaxation More Central America Headlines -- The Prairies: Sculpted by glaciers Like the adjoining Boreal Plains to the north, glaciers have largely flattened the land here, leaving behind a thick layer of dark, humus-rich topsoil that has made the Prairies very fertile, and created Canada's most extensive agricultural region. But it is mainly because of farming that the once ubiquitous grasslands, the northern limit of the Great Plains of North America, are now mostly gone. Downtown Buenos Aires combines history, culture and architecture. We start this city walk from Plaza de Mayo, where the town was born more than four centuries ago. We walk through the oldest and narrow streets of the protected district of Monserrat, discovering the city's famous landmarks, major churches and astonishing buildings. We recall the historic transformation of the southern village, now commonly referred to as the Paris of South America. The visit includes San Telmo and Recoleta cemetery. Just north of Buenos Aires, the island city of Tigre is a region Argentinean travelers should not miss. A serene riverside train ride takes us into Tigre. Visit the famous fruit market. Rustic weaves, cane and willow furniture, sugary sweets, exotic flowers and, of course, numerous varieties of native fruit temp you as you make your way through this bustling market. A guided tour of the beautiful Delta ends this excursion.
